Chrysler (FCA US LLC) is recalling certain model year 2014-2015 Jeep Cherokee and 2015 Chrysler 200, Jeep Renegade, RAM ProMaster, and 2016 Fiat 500X vehicles equipped with 9-speed automatic transmissions. The transmission sensor clusters may have insufficient crimps in the transmission wire harness, and as a result, the transmission may unexpectedly shift to neutral. On August 29, 2016 Chrysler added the 2016 Fiat 500X vehicles to this recall.

Are 2016 FIAT 500X recalls free to fix?
Yes! All safety recalls for 2016 FIAT 500X vehicles must be repaired free of charge by authorized dealers, regardless of vehicle age or mileage. Contact your local FIAT dealer to schedule a recall repair.
